FYI - I have not conditioned any of my Givenchy leathers just yet. The oldest bag, my pepe Pandora, is about 1.5 yrs and still looks like new.

The only thing I have done is sprayed them all with Vectra to prevent stains, even the black bags. It came in handy a few days ago when a waiter dropped a small dish of salsa on my black pepe Pandora (it was sitting on its own chair). It was very dark in the restaurant and I thought that I had wiped everything off the bag, but when I got home a few hours later I noticed several dried up spots of tomato gunk. It all came off with a damp cloth and there is no evidence of the spill, which was a pleasant surprise. Although the black is dark enough to disguise a salsa stain, with the high acidity of tomatoes I would have expected a little outline or some other damage to the leather's surface but it's still in perfect condition.

I spray Vectra on everything - bags, shoes, furniture, etc.! It really works.

I don't recall that the pepe leather seemed stiff or dry to me when I first received the bag - but, that was the first Givenchy in my collection so I didn't have any expectations. It is definitely soft and slouchy today! Although, objectively, the surface of the leather doesn't feel as soft to the touch as my calf or goat bags.

Pepe is such a great leather for everyday; it feels like it was designed to ward off and conceal stains, scratches, or imperfections of any kind. I saw a photo once of an Antigona in pepe leather and I would jump on the opportunity to add one of those to my collection!
